> I have committed rev 190402, which merges the cxx-conversion branch into
> trunk.  Thanks to everyone who provided review feedback and tested the
> branch.
>
> While we have tested the changes pretty thoroughly, we will monitor results
> from testers for any new failures introduced by these changes. Please CC
> myself and Lawrence on any issues that may be related to the C++ changes.
>
> As discussed in http://gcc.gnu.org/ml/gcc-patches/2012-08/msg00711.html,
> there are no functional changes to the compiler. We tried very hard to limit
> the amount of API changes we introduced to minimize merge conflicts.
>
> Now that the changes are in trunk we will start changing the APIs to take
> advantage of the re-written data structures.
>
> I have also committed the changes to the home page news section and 4.8
> changes to reflect the new implementation language.
